Popular Holi Celebrations in Mumbai
Mumbai's Holi celebrations are marked by a rich array of activities and venues, each with its own unique atmosphere. Here are some of the top destinations where you can indulge in the festive spirit:
Juhu Beach
Renowned for its lively beach parties, Juhu Beach is a popular spot for Holi festivities. The beach hosts large gatherings where people come together to celebrate with colors, music, and dance. Revel in the vibrant hues spilled across the sands as you join in the fun.
Bandra
Bandra, a trendy suburb, is known for its energetic Holi celebrations, especially around Bandra Fort. Locals and tourists alike enjoy the festivities with vibrant colors, music, and dance. This is a great place to experience the festival's lively atmosphere.
Chowpatty Beach
Another popular beach destination, Chowpatty is celebrated for its festive vibes. Many events feature music, food stalls, and color play. For a truly memorable experience, visit during Holi to witness the energy and joy of the color-fest.
Gulal and Water Parties
Hotels and clubs in Mumbai organize special Holi events with lavish celebrations. These parties include color throwing, DJ music, and gourmet food. Luxury hotels like The Leela Taj Mahal Palace often host extravagant Holi events. These venues offer a glamorous and luxurious way to celebrate the festival.
Local Societies and Communities
Many housing societies in Mumbai organize their own Holi events, creating an intimate and community-oriented setting. These events offer a distinctly local flavor to the festivities, making them a great opportunity to experience Holi in a more traditional and personal manner.
Religious Celebrations
The Iskcon Temple, the International Society for Krishna Consciousness, hosts a spiritual Holi celebration. This event features traditional music, dance, and colors, providing a unique and purely spiritual experience of the festival.
